A study on the sound field in a vault with two open ends

  • This article studies the difference of sound pressure distribution in a vault with two open ends and in enclosure and long space,by comparing classic Sabine Formula,modified Sabine Formula and ray tracing method's accurate estimation on this kind of space,and at the same time discusses the non-exponential decay curve occurred in that,analyzes the reason of its occurrence,elements and rules of why it has been influenced.Ray tracing method has been used to conduct numerical simulation in this article and results of experiments have been compared with the numerical results to verify the conclusion.The steady sound pressure distribution in the vault with open ends is obviously different from that in enclosure and long space.The classic Sabine Formula can not be used to calculate reverberation time and the estimation of steady sound pressure by ray tracing method is trivial.As for the reason of the occurrence of non-exponential decay curve,it is because the coupling of sound energy between small zones of different "live" degrees within the space and it also depends on if requirements of double-sloped decay curve in coupled volumes theory can be fulfilled or not.If the distance between the observation spot and sound source is not big and both of them are not in the middle of the space,then double-sloped decay curve could be observed very obviously.
